Marv The Marsh aka. Marvin The Martian and briefly known simply as Marvin, is a Brixton born rapper who is largley credited as the inventor of the musical genre Grindie. Having sampled Art Brut's 'Emily Kane' to create 'Stay Off The Kane' (a song released as a free download through Artrocker.com in 2005) many journalists coined the phrase Grindie to mean the fusion of Grime and Indie music. Marv The Marsh has since sampled Columbia Records signed band GoodBooks as well as ungerground band Kalev with his group Why Lout? but largely rejects the genre as a tag for his music. Marv The Marsh signed a pioneering deal with Universal Records in 2005 which has seen the release of an E.P (Hoods & Badges) and a forthcoming single 'I Hate My Job' to be released in October 2006. Marvin The Martian releases his as yet untitled debut L.P through No Carbon/ Universal Records in September 2007 following controversial single release 'Guns Of Brixton' which is a take on The Clash's classic single.
